This modernist pendant was designed and manufactured in sweden in the 1940s by asea belysning (allmänna svenska elektriska aktiebolaget). The light features a smooth, large opaline glass shade in a rounded, tapered form, complemented by a brass cone shaped canopy and short light rod. This 1940s pendant showcases a minimalist yet elegant design typical of mid-century european lighting, combining clean lines with warm metallic accents. Some minor patina on the brass pieces.
